IELTS Writing Task 2 question

Write about the following topic:

In many countries, family members work together in their family business.

Do you think family businesses have more advantages than disadvantages?

Give reasons for your answer and include any relevant examples from your own knowledge or experience.

Student answer (Band 6.0)

Most of the family members are working together to run their family businesses. I strongly agree that family businesses are more advantageous and this essay will discuss how these benefits out way their drawbacks.

To begin with, there are an array of advantages connected with the family firm, but the most significant one is saving money. When young adults join their own business, they can save money by not hiring in - experienced or new person. As if they hire any new graduate, they have to invest on their training and teach them the goals of the organization. As a result, hiring of experienced members of the family not only save their finances, but also save their time. Furthermore, the family businesses lead to quick decision making. When whole family is working towards the same goal, it is feasible to take decisions in favour of the firm rather than employees. Hence, the owners can focus specifically on the cons of the business.

Although, family led businesses are beneficial, lack of personal time is the significant problem. In order to keep running the businesses for long time, the young adults have to put more efforts and they cannot enjoy any day off because they have to stay available anytime . Consequently, it decreases their personal time and efficiency by the time.

In conclusion, although the privately held company demands more efforts, the benefits like saving money as well as quick decision making are more effective. So, the advantages of running family led businesses can never be ignored.

Task Achievement / Task Response — Band 6.0

The response addresses all parts of the prompt, clearly stating a position in the introduction and maintaining it throughout. The ideas regarding cost-saving and decision-making are relevant, though the development is somewhat limited. For instance, the argument about 'saving money' by not hiring new graduates is a valid point, but it could be expanded with more specific examples or deeper analysis to reach a higher band. The counter-argument regarding personal time is also relevant but remains brief. Overall, the response is well-focused, but the depth of explanation for the supporting points is slightly underdeveloped, which is characteristic of a Band 6.0 performance.

Coherence and Cohesion — Band 6.5

The essay is logically organized into clear paragraphs. There is a progression of ideas from the introduction to the body paragraphs and the conclusion. Cohesive devices such as 'To begin with', 'Furthermore', 'As a result', and 'In conclusion' are used effectively to link sentences and ideas. However, some transitions feel slightly mechanical, and there are minor issues with referencing, such as the use of 'the' before 'family businesses' in some contexts where it is not required. Paragraphing is used appropriately, and the overall structure supports the reader's understanding of the argument.

Lexical Resource — Band 6.0

The vocabulary is generally adequate for the task, allowing the writer to convey their meaning clearly. There are some attempts to use less common vocabulary, such as 'feasible' and 'privately held company'. However, there are some inaccuracies in word choice and collocation, such as 'hiring in - experienced' (should be 'inexperienced') and 'out way' (should be 'outweigh'). The range is sufficient to discuss the topic, but the lack of precision and occasional errors in word formation prevent a higher score. The vocabulary is functional but lacks the sophistication required for higher bands.

Grammatical Range and Accuracy — Band 6.0

The essay uses a mix of simple and complex sentence structures. While the meaning is generally clear, there are frequent grammatical errors, such as 'Most of the family members are working' (should be 'Most family members work'), 'hiring of experienced members' (should be 'hiring experienced members'), and 'the whole family is' (should be 'the whole family'). Punctuation is generally acceptable, but there are minor issues with spacing and article usage. The errors do not impede communication, but they are frequent enough to prevent the response from reaching a higher band. A greater variety of error-free complex structures is needed.
